I am a customer of FGB (now called First Abu Dhabi Bank, FAB) since December 2015. I took a credit card and a flexi plan under the same card via FGB sales agent in January 2016. On processing the loan, sales agent and its representative during the verification call stated, if I do pre-cancellation of my plans then I will only have to pay one per cent of total outstanding amount with total outstating Principal amount. I was happy with the offer. Since 2016 till date I took several plans under the same card and have been a loyal customer and never missed any payment.

In April 2017, I started to close my Equated Monthly Instalment (EMI) plans one by one. The biggest plan was of Dh37,800; for which I have already paid 18 months and 18 months are pending (Plan tenure was 36 months).

In order to close the above mentioned plan, I called customer care representative twice in May, and they mentioned to me that closing balance for that particular EMI flexi plan is approximately Dh21,000. I was fine as they told me the outstanding plus one per cent of the total outstanding will be charged.

Then I called them in June, and the customer service representative said that after paying of monthly EMI for June, my final settlement payment was approximately Dh19,089. I said OK I will do the closure in August.

Now, when I called the bank after all these months, working hard saving money to close the plan, the bank is asking me to pay approximately Dh25,700.

They are asking me now to pay interest, that is, 18 months EMI left, I need to pay all (per month EMI is Dh1,424.22).I was shocked and shattered.

I asked him how come? He said, your booking for plan was done in January 2016, that is why my amount to be paid is Dh25,700; if booking is done in February, then the amount to be paid is approximately Dh19,089.

I raised a complaint afterwards, as I have been planning for this from the past three months and four customer service representatives have told me that I do not need to pay interest if I close my flexi plans early.

I even spoke to my sales agent who gave me the card, he too agreed that I am not liable to pay interest. I only need to pay the principal outstanding and one per cent closing charges of principal.

Previously also in January 2017, they charged me credit card fees of Dh500 but as sales agent sold card to me saying that card is free for life then I raised a complaint and they reversed the fees. But this time they are just crossing limit, please help me. They are just turning their back now.

I would appreciate your kind help in this matter, as I raised a complaint with FGB on August 6, which they closed on August 7 without my satisfaction and consent; and then later I asked to reopen but they opened new on August 7 again under the same issue and till today no calls, no emails, no action have been taken by FGB.

The management of FAB responds: FAB supports the growth ambitions of its stakeholders and goes beyond financial products and services, and as such, we are grateful for all customer feedback as we strive to consistently deliver the highest standards of service. The bank has been in contact with Ms. Singh, and the matter has been resolved.

Ms Singh responds: Regarding my issue with FGB for closure of flexi plan, which I took in January 2016, please note the bank representative had worked on the issue and had given me approval to pay only one per cent of principal amount and principal outstanding. Today I am going to finish off the plan.
